Overview:

We are seeking a motivated Field Low Voltage Project Manager Assistant to join our team. In this role, you will assist with the planning, coordination, scheduling, and execution of commercial low voltage projects while supporting senior project management staff and installation teams. This is an excellent opportunity for someone looking to grow their career in project management within the low voltage and fire life safety industry.

Responsibilities:
  • Assist in the coordination and execution of commercial low voltage and fire life safety projects in multifamily and commercial buildings.
  • Attend job site meetings as required.
  • Support Project Managers and field teams with scheduling, material tracking, and project documentation.
  • Help coordinate installation activities with technicians, installers, foremen, customers, and subcontractors.
  • Track project progress and communicate updates to management and customers as needed.
  • Review project drawings, specifications, and shop drawings to become familiar with project scope and requirements.
  • Assist with material procurement, equipment deliveries, and project closeout documentation.
  • Help identify and communicate project issues, change requests, or scheduling conflicts to senior management.
  • Coordinate with other trades on job sites to support efficient project completion.
  • Participate in customer meetings and job walks alongside senior project staff.
  • Assist with preparing project reports, billing documentation, and schedules of values.
  • Support troubleshooting and problem-solving efforts during installation and commissioning phases.
  • Maintain organized project files and complete required company paperwork accurately and on time.
  • Provide professional and timely communication with customers, vendors, and team members.

HCI Systems Inc. is a licensed C-7, C-10 and C-16 low voltage systems integration contractor offering a full spectrum of services including sales, engineering, installation, service, and maintenance with over 600 employees in our seven branches. We offer fire life safety, fire suppression, fire sprinkler, access control, video management, intrusion detection, structured cable, nurse call and other related electronic detection solutions to our customers.
